‘Life Sharing Blood Donation’
 

Chungju Shincheonji volunteers had held the event of ‘life sharing blood donation’ from 9:30AM to 4:30PM on December 7.

Three buses were provided by The Republic of Korea National Red Cross, Chungbuk Blood bank for approx. 400 people from Shincheonji volunteer group to participate.

Lee Jae Yun(50) who was participated in blood donation on that day said “I’m glad to save precious life by this little sacrifice wishing this blood becomes the hope for patients who fight for disease.

A branch manager of Chungju Shincheonji volunteers mentioned the purpose of this event saying “we wish this donation would solve imbalance between supply and demand in winter. Furthermore, we will perform love of neighbor through consistent love and life sharing events.”

People from The Republic of Korea National Red Cross, Chungbuk Blood Bank expressed their gratitude for participating blood donation of Shincheonji volunteer group members. A person concerned mentioned “Thank you so much on your cooperation. Even megachurch members rarely volunteer on blood donation. We will use it with loving care.”

Meanwhile, Chungju Shincheonji volunteers has been contributing their talent to the public in various ways such as wall painting, loving country sharing peace, free medical services to foreigners residing in Korea, cleaning street, teaching Korean to foreigners residing in Korea and making Kim-chi for the winter.
